薄层扫描快速检测发酵液中琥珀酸

Determination of succinic acid in fermentation broth using thin layer scanning technique
原文传递
导出
摘要 基于CuSO4与发酵液中琥珀酸的显色反应,在硅胶板上不经层析展开使用薄层扫描定量分析琥珀酸含量。在0~12 g/L范围内,测定波长680 nm,参比波长500 nm条件下,琥珀酸浓度与显色斑吸光度呈良好线性关系。方法检出限(3 S/k)为0.028 mg/L,回收率94.80%~96.12%,相对标准偏差≤3.5%(n=5)。发酵液中副产物的干扰率≤5.60%。本研究可为实验室研究或工业生产提供一种简便高效的琥珀酸定量检测方法。 Based on color reaction between copper sulfate and succinic acid in fermentation broth,succinic acid concentration was determined directly by using thin layer scanning without chromatography.Linear relationship between the value of absorbance and the succinic acid concentration was obtained in the range of 0-12 g/L,using 680 nm as measurement wavelength and 500 nm as reference wavelength for scanning.The method detection limit(3 S/k) was 0.028 mg/L with the recoveries of 94.8%~96.1%,and the RSD(n=5) was lower than 3.5%.The interference rate of byproducts was lower than 5.60%.The paper provided an easy but efficient method for the determination of succinic acid in lab study or industry production.
